Vibe-Guard
Vibe-Coding 民主化 — AI も完璧じゃない、を tool が体現。Intervention Works 直営プロダクト第一弾。
AI が「完璧な答え」を吐き続ける時代に、「気づけたことを祝う」を実装する MCP server。 Vibe Coder(動かしたい人 + 学びたい人)のための補助輪 + 教育インフラ。
生成 AI で「なんとなく動くもの」は作れる。
でも、セーフティも、学びも、置き去りになる。
Vibe-Guard は、Claude Code に Why-How-Now (WHN) のレールを差し込む。 検出は失敗の証拠じゃなく、いま気づけた成功。記録は罰じゃなく、Vibe Coder の portfolio。
core / 介入の対象AI 信仰へのアンチテーゼ
AI を「権威」として崇める時代の構造に、tool 自身が異議を申し立てる craft。 Vibe-Guard は自分の限界も率直に言う —— 完璧じゃないと、tool が自分で名乗る。
「AI も完璧ちゃうねんで?」
— 2026-05-01 朝、起源の一言
contrastClaude Code と何が違うか
| Claude Code | Vibe-Guard | |
|---|---|---|
| ターゲット | 既存エンジニア | Vibe Coder(動かしたい + 学びたい) |
| 価値の中心 | スキルの増幅 | スキルの獲得 |
| 隠喩 | 副操縦士 | 補助輪 + 教育インフラ |
dna / 4 つの温度Vibe-Guard が大切にしてること
- 気づけたことを祝う — 検出は失敗の証拠じゃなく、今気づけた成功
- 失敗の前史を許容する — 過去の自分のコードを今の自分が直す
- 完璧じゃないと率直に言う — Vibe-Guard 自身も誤検出する、AI 信仰アンチテーゼ
- 記録は罰じゃなく成長の証拠 — Vibe Coder の portfolio になる
what it does提供する機能(柱 ①)
秘匿情報保護 / Git 自動防衛 / 危険コマンドのリスク判定。すべての警告に Why-How-Now の 3 段解説が付く。
- scan-secrets — ソース内シークレット直書き検出(confidence 評価付き)
- propose-fix-secret / batch — 単一 / 一括の修正 diff 提案
- check-env — `.env` / `.gitignore` / `.env.example` 診断
- propose-fix-gitignore — `.gitignore` 新規作成 / 追記提案
- explain-command — 危険コマンド翻訳(sudo / rm -rf 等)
- propose-hook-settings — Hook 設定の処方箋
Vibe-Guard は自動適用しない。「これでいい?」の承認余地を必ず残す。これも AI 信仰アンチテーゼ craft の一部。
why iwなぜ Intervention Works 直営なのか
Vibe-Guard の DNA は、IW 屋号思想「Intervene in the world. Rebel against their values.」そのもの。
AI ツールの「権威化」「絶対視」に介入し、tool 自身が「完璧じゃない」と名乗る craft は、 既存のソフトウェア業界の前提に対する小さな反乱。だから、Wit-One の「ゲーム業界向け AI Ops」より、IW 直営の「業界の前提に介入する」と一直線に繋がる。